Among a number of interfaces for connecting hard drives to a computer, the main ones can be distinguished:

IDE - at the moment the connector is outdated and hardly used. At one time, it allowed connecting two drives at once through one loop.
SATA is the most popular connector found in most computers. Its distinctive feature is the serial data transfer between the carrier and the receiving device (computer).
FireWire (IEEE 1394) is one of the options for how to connect 2 hard drives to your computer. It is most often used to connect to external storage media and is designed for a maximum data transfer rate of about 300 Mbps.

Connecting the hard drive to the motherboard

The bolts are fixed, and we move on to the wires and loops. Connect with which the HDD will communicate with it.

Depending on the type of HDD, they will differ - ATA (IDE) and SATA. The first are older, the second are new, but both are still on sale.

Connecting an IDE hard drive to the motherboard is carried out using a ribbon cable, which has a large number of contacts, pins, and therefore is wide. The loop has a lock that prevents it from being connected incorrectly. Therefore, it is impossible to make a mistake. Connect the IDE cable between the HDD and the motherboard.

A SATA hard drive is connected using a narrow ribbon cable. It will be impossible to mix up the connection sockets on the motherboard, since SATA will fit only in the correct connector. Use a SATA cable to connect the HDD to the motherboard.

Connecting the hard drive to power

Power cables are also different for IDE and SATA hard drives. Most for one and the other type or there are special adapters.

To connect IDE hard drives, use a 4-pin Peripheral Power Connector. SATA hard drives require a SATA Power Connector. In both cases, you cannot mix up the connections, so do not be afraid that you will do something wrong.

Differences between connecting IDE and SATA hard drives

It would seem that the connection procedure is the same, but in fact IDE differs slightly from SATA in that it requires setting the position of the jumper, the so-called jumper.

The motherboard is usually supplied with a pair of connectors for IDE devices, and each can be connected to two devices. Each pair can have one master and one slave, and it is impossible that there are two identical. The hard disk must be in master position if Windows boots from it. The second device in the same connection branch must be slave.

If all this is difficult to understand, then just put a jumper on master if your computer has only one hard disk.

You can find the jumper connection card on the hard drive case itself.

There are no such problems with SATA. Master and slave positions are set via BIOS. When connecting a SATA hard drive, you will need to configure it as bootable if an operating system is installed on it.

Physical disk connection

If the system unit has not yet been disassembled, disassemble it. It is now recommended to get rid of static electricity. This is done by any means known to you. If you wish, you can purchase a special grounding strap in the store.

After small manipulations, the hard drive will be fixed in the case, now all that remains is to connect the hard drive. Before plugging in the power cable and ribbon cable, please note that the procedure is slightly different for IDE and SATA interfaces.

IDE interface

When connecting a disk with an IDE interface, it is recommended to pay attention to such a nuance as setting the operating mode:

  1. Master (main).
  2. Slave (slave).

If an additional hard disk is installed, then you must enable the Slave mode. To do this, you need to use a jumper (jumper), which is installed in the second place. The first row turns on the Master mode. It is important to note that on modern computers, the jumper can be removed completely. The system will automatically detect which hard master.

At the next step, you need to connect the second or third hard disk to the "mother". For this, the IDE interface is connected to a ribbon cable (wide, thin wire). The other end of the cable is connected to the IDE 1 Secondary socket (the main drive is connected to the zero connector).

The final stage of connection is power supply. To do this, a white chip with four wires is connected to the corresponding connector. The wires go directly from the power supply (box with wires and fan).

SATA interface

Unlike IDE, a SATA drive has two L-shaped connectors. One is for power connection and the other is for data cable. It should be noted that such a hard drive lacks a jumper.

The data cable plugs into a narrow connector. The other end connects to a special connector. Most often there are 4 such ports on the motherboard, but there are only 2 ports with an exception. One of the slots can be occupied by a DVD drive.

There are times when a disk with a SATA interface was purchased, but no such connectors were found on the motherboard. In this case, it is recommended to additionally purchase a SATA controller, which is installed in the PCI slot.

The next step is to connect the power. The L-shaped wide cable is connected to the corresponding connector. If the drive has an additional power connector (IDE interface), just use one of the connectors. This completes the physical connection of the hard drive.

The final stage

Since connecting a hard drive to a computer is not enough, you need to make the final settings directly from under Windows. On some computers, this procedure is performed automatically. To check this, you should open "My Computer" and then see if a new disk appears.

If nothing happened, you need to start the control panel. Then select "Administration". Once a new window opens, you will need to select "Computer Management". In the left column, you need to find the "Disk Management" tab (on some computers "Disk Manager").

  • Select disk 1 at the bottom of the window (if more than 2 hard drives are connected, select the disk with the highest number). This will be the new hard drive;
  • You must assign a letter to the logical volume. To do this, right-click on the disk, and then select "Assign letter";
  • As soon as a new drive letter is assigned, it needs to be formatted. The procedure can take a long time, it all depends on the size of the hard drive. It is important to choose the NTFS file system when formatting.

When the formatting process is complete, a new disk will appear in the root directory "My Computer". If for some reason it is not possible to connect the HDD using the built-in manager, it is recommended to use third-party programs.

Ways to connect 2 drives to a laptop

Option number 1: install the disk in the second slot in the laptop

Some laptops have two slots for hard drives (though I want to say right away that the configuration of such laptops is quite rare). Basically, these laptops belong to the category of gaming and are quite expensive.

To find out how many slots you have, just look at those. characteristics of the laptop (if you do not have documents for the device, you can look on the Internet), or simply remove the protective cover from the back of the laptop and take a look yourself (Important! Do not open the lid if the laptop is under warranty - this may be the reason for the denial of warranty service).

Option number 2: install the SSD in the spec. connector (M.2)

If you have a new modern laptop, it is possible that you have an M.2 connector (SSD connector, present in many new products (usually in those that are more expensive ☺)). Designed as a replacement for mSATA. Allows you to get the maximum performance from installing an SSD drive.

To find out if you have such a connector, you can:

  1. knowing the laptop model (about), look at its tech. characteristics (the Internet is full of sites with all models of mobile devices ☺);
  2. you can simply open the back cover of the laptop and personally look for the desired connector.

Option number 3: connect the external HDD / SSD to the USB port

An external hard drive can significantly expand the space. It looks like a small box, the size of a regular phone. Connects to a regular USB port. Such a disk, on average today, is able to accommodate about 1000-4000 GB (i.e. 1-4 TB).

If you are considering models with additional power (the adapter usually comes with some drives), then the capacity can reach up to 8 TB! I think that over time it will be even higher.

There is truth in this version, certain disadvantages: extra wires on the table, lower speed of interaction with the disk (if HDD - then on average up to 60 MB / s via USB 3.0), and the inconvenience of carrying a laptop (it's one thing to take a laptop in one hand and go, and another is to additionally fiddle with an external drive ...).

True, there are undeniable advantages: such a disk can be connected to any laptop or PC, it can be used to transfer information from one PC to another (it will not take much space in your pocket), you can buy several such disks and use them one by one.

Option # 4: install another disc instead of the CD / DVD drive

Well, the most popular option is to remove the CD / DVD drive from the laptop (available in the vast majority of models) and instead insert a special adapter (some call it a "pocket") with another disk (HDD or SSD). I will paint this option in more detail ...

What adapter do you need? Determining ...

First you need to find and choose this adapter correctly. In our ordinary computer stores, it is rare (you need to order in some Chinese online store, for example, in AliExpress -).

Note: in English, such an adapter is called "caddy for laptop" (this is how you enter a query in the search bar of stores).

Universal adapter for installing a second disk in a laptop instead of a CD-ROM drive (2nd HDD Caddy 12.7 mm 2.5 SATA 3.0)

There are 2 important points:

  • adapters are of different thicknesses! Actually, just like discs and CD / DVD drives. The most common are 12.7 mm and 9.5 mm. Those. before buying an adapter - you need to measure the thickness of the CD / DVD drive(best with a pair of compasses, at worst with a ruler)!
  • disks and CD / DVD drive can come with different ports (SATA, IDE). Those. it is necessary, again, to look at the installed CD / DVD drive live. Most often, modern laptops are equipped with drives that support SATA (they are most popular in Chinese stores).

How to remove a CD / DVD drive from a laptop

In general, of course, a lot depends on the design of your laptop. The most common case: there is a special protective cover on the back of the laptop, removing which you can see the fastening screw that fixes the drive in the laptop slot. Accordingly, by unscrewing this screw, you can freely remove the drive.

Some laptop models do not have a protective cover - and in order to get to the insides, you need to completely disassemble the device.

Note: before removing the protective cover (and indeed, carrying out any manipulations with the laptop), unplug it from the mains and remove the battery.

Most often, the drive is fixed with one screw (see photo below). To remove it, in most cases, you will need a Phillips screwdriver.

After the screw is removed, it is enough to slightly pull on the drive tray - it should "come out" from the tray with a little effort (see photo below).

Installing an SSD / HDD disk into an adapter, and an adapter into a laptop

Installing an SSD / HDD disk into an adapter is easy. It is enough to put it in the special. "pocket", then insert it into the internal port and fix it with screws (screws are included with the adapter).

The photo below shows the installed SSD drive in a similar adapter.

If the thickness of the adapter and the disc has been chosen correctly (no more than the thickness of the CD / DVD drive), then you can easily push it into the slot and fix it with a screw (if the adapter has such a mount).

If the thickness of the disc / adapter is selected correctly, but there are problems with insertion into the slot, pay attention to the compensating screws on the adapter: some models are equipped with them (located on the side walls of the adapter). Just take them off (or drown them).

After the adapter with the disk is installed in the slot for the drive, put a neat panel on the adapter so that it looks like a real drive and does not spoil the look of the laptop. Such sockets, as a rule, always come with adapters in the kit (in addition, they can be removed from the removed CD-ROM drive).

Checking if the drive appears in BIOS

After installing the second disk, I recommend that after turning on the laptop, go immediately into the BIOS and see if the disk is detected, if you can see it. Most often, the identified disks can be found in the main menu: main, information and so on (see photo below).

    Replacing the optical drive

      Buy an internal hard drive. If you don't have an external hard drive or free space inside the computer case, remove the optical drive from it. Installing a standard 3.5-inch internal hard drive is a good and inexpensive way to expand your computer's storage.

      • The internal hard drive and optical drive are connected to the motherboard via an IDE cable or SATA cable. Some hard drives are sold with the required cable, while others do not, so in this case you need to buy the cable separately.
    1. Buy matching adapters. In most cases, the optical drive fits into a 5.25 "bay, which is large for a 3.5" hard drive. So read your optical drive's documentation to find out its size.

      • A bay is a limited space inside a computer case where an optical drive, disk drive, or hard drive can be inserted. To install a hard drive in a larger bay, special adapters or brackets are used.
    2. Unplug the power cord from the computer. Before working on computer components, be sure to disconnect power from them.

      Open the computer case. Use a screwdriver to remove the side panel of the case (some cases can be opened without a screwdriver). The type of screwdriver depends on the model and manufacturer of the case.

      Disconnect the cables connected to the optical drive. In the vast majority of cases, two cables are connected to an optical drive: a power cable and a data cable.

      • The power cable has a white plug and black, yellow and red wires.
      • The flat ("ribbon") data cable has a wide plug.
    3. Remove the screws or open the latches securing the optical drive. Once done, remove the drive from the housing.

      Install bracket or adapter (if needed). Fix the bracket or adapter with screws.

      Insert the internal hard drive into the vacated bay. Insert the hard drive into the bay and secure with the screws.

      Connect the hard drive to the motherboard. To do this, connect the power cable and data cable to the hard drive.

      Connect the power cable to the computer. You must turn on your computer to configure it to use the new hard drive.

    4. Enter BIOS. BIOS (Basic Input / Output System) is the software that the processor needs to identify the installed components and hardware, such as an additional hard drive. The method of entering and making changes to the BIOS depends on the manufacturer and model of the motherboard. Read the documentation for your motherboard to find out how to enter the BIOS and open the Hardware section.

      • Turn on the computer and immediately hold down the corresponding key.
      • Once in the BIOS, find the section (or tab) “Hardware”, “Setup”, or similar. Navigation inside the BIOS is done using the keyboard.
      • The installed hard drive should appear in the list. If it is not listed, turn off your computer and check that the appropriate cables are securely connected.
      • Find and activate the "Auto-detect" option.
      • Save your changes and exit BIOS. To do this, you need to press a certain key. The computer will automatically restart.
    5. Format your hard drive. Before using the hard drive, you must format it with a file system that is compatible with your operating system. If you plan to install on a Windows hard drive, format it with NTFS, or xFAT or FAT32 for simple data storage. The following procedure is for Windows 10 users, but most likely applies to other versions of this system as well.

      • Press Win + R to open the Run window.
      • Enter diskmgmt.msc and click OK. The disk management utility starts.
      • In the list, right-click on the new hard drive and choose Format from the menu.
      • Select the desired file system and click OK. The process of formatting the disk will take some time (depending on the size of the disk). After the formatting process is complete, you can use the hard drive.
    • The IDE cable has two or three plugs. One end of the cable connects to the motherboard and the other to the device (hard drive or optical drive). A maximum of two devices can be connected to one IDE cable. If your motherboard does not have a free IDE connector, install an additional board with an IDE connector. If your motherboard supports Serial ATA (SATA), use hard drives with this interface (data transfer rates will increase significantly). Many motherboard models support up to four SATA hard drives (in the case of an IDE interface, you can only connect two drives), allowing you to create a RAID array.
